Can I Slim Down in 7 Days? A Practical Guide to Quick Weight Loss
Achieve noticeable results with healthy habits and a focused plan

When you’re gearing up for an event or simply want to jumpstart your weight loss journey, slimming down in just seven days can feel like a tall order. While achieving drastic results in a week isn’t realistic or healthy, adopting certain habits can help you feel lighter, reduce bloating, and shed a few pounds. Here's a science-backed guide to help you slim down effectively in just seven days.
1. Focus on Nutrition
The foundation of quick and sustainable weight loss lies in your diet. For seven days, focus on consuming nutrient-dense, low-calorie foods.
• Reduce Carbohydrate Intake: Lowering your carbohydrate consumption helps reduce water retention, which can lead to a noticeable drop in weight. Replace refined crabs with v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ats.
• Hydrate Wisely: Drinking plenty of water not only keeps you hydrated but also helps flush out toxins. Aim for at least 8–10 glasses a day.
• Eat Smaller Portions: Instead of three large meals, eat smaller, more frequent meals to boost metabolism and curb hunger.
• Cut Out Processed Foods: Avoid processed snacks, sugary drinks, and fast food, as they can lead to bloating and weight gain.
2. Incorporate High-Intensity Workouts
Exercise plays a crucial role in burning calories and toning your body. To see results in seven days, focus on high-intensity interval training (HIIT) or circuit workouts.
• HIIT Workouts: Alternating short bursts of intense exercise with periods of rest can burn more calories in a shorter time. For example, try 20 seconds of sprinting followed by 40 seconds of walking for 15–20 minutes.
• Strength Training: Include bodyweight exercises like squats, push-ups, and lunges to tone your muscles and boost metabolism.
• Stay Active All Day: Beyond your workouts, keep moving. Walk, stretch, or take the stairs whenever possible.
3. Manage Bloating
Sometimes, the key to looking slimmer isn’t fat loss but reducing bloating. Simple tweaks can help:
• Avoid Salt: Excess sodium causes water retention, leading to bloating. opt for herbs and spices to flavour your meals.
• Limit Gas-Producing Foods: Avoid foods like beans, broccoli, and carbonated drinks, which can cause gas.
• Try a Probiotic: Yogurt or probiotic supplements can support gut health and reduce bloating.
4. Prioritize Sleep
Quality sleep is often overlooked in weight loss plans. Lack of sleep can lead to increased hunger and cravings, hindering your progress.
• Aim for 7–8 Hours: Create a calming bedtime routine and stick to a consistent sleep schedule.
• Reduce Screen Time: Avoid screens at least an hour before bed to improve sleep quality.
• Lower Stress Levels: Practice mindfulness or yoga to reduce stress, which can contribute to weight gain.
5. Track Your Progress
Monitoring your habits can help you stay on track and motivated.
• Keep a Food Journal: Write down what you eat to ensure you’re staying within your calorie goals.
• Weigh Yourself Daily: While weight fluctuates naturally, tracking it can help you see trends.
• Celebrate Non-Scale Victories: Notice changes in how your clothes fit or improvements in energy levels.
Realistic Expectations
While you can achieve noticeable changes in seven days, it’s crucial to set realistic goals. Most of the weight lost in this period will likely be water weight, not fat. Sustainable fat loss typically occurs at a rate of 1–2 pounds per week.
Long-Term Benefits
Although this seven-day plan can give you a head start, it’s important to view it as a foundation for a longer-term lifestyle change. Healthy eating, regular exercise, and stress management are key to maintaining your results.
Final Thoughts
Slimming down in seven days is possible, but the results will be subtle. By focusing on clean eating, regular exercise, and proper hydration, you can reduce bloating and shed a few pounds. Most importantly, use this week as a stepping stone to establish healthier habits that will support your goals in the long run.
